Output 7a404137645334ce49ea498dc8e640ba98eb620bd7f9aeb7968bbbd3cb717237:0

value
654119855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a23bbdc4657a0fe8b8815d2b9edb67d8386912 OP_EQUAL
address
3QB6VuVPca8tFYU3FNKA2MSGiQY18mSyXC
transaction
7a404137645334ce49ea498dc8e640ba98eb620bd7f9aeb7968bbbd3cb717237
spent
true